Deforestation can have positive effects such as increased agricultural land and economic development, as it allows for the expansion of farming and infrastructure. However, the negative effects are more pronounced, including loss of biodiversity, disruption of ecosystems, and contribution to climate change due to increased carbon emissions. Additionally, deforestation can lead to soil erosion and negatively impact indigenous communities that rely on forests for their livelihoods. Overall, the long-term consequences often outweigh the short-term benefits.

Land destruction refers to the deliberate act of destroying or rendering unusable a piece of land, such as through deforestation, strip mining, or urban development. This can have negative effects on ecosystems, biodiversity, and local communities that rely on the land for resources. It is often done for economic gain with little regard for the environmental impact.
